Description
Detective Maizuru Motoya has a secret he cannot tell his assistant, whom he is in love with. With a single touch of a person, Motoya can read their thoughts. How he got such ability is in the past. Nakagawa, who doesn't know about his respectful boss's special ability, began to worry when Motoya refuses to let come in contact with him. To add more worry, Motoya is awfully close with his old friend...

You can tell Yubisaki no Koi was drawn before Naono found her groove, as the characters look a little weird at times (Nakagawa's neck during the first love scene always freaks me out; he looks like some monster from a Final Fantasy game). The story makes up for any visual shortcomings, and it's a good attention grabber. I really love the kidnapping chapters, even if they are a little cliched. Bonus points for Nakagawa's present.

I like that it was adapted to a drama CD, though my only complaint is that Maizuru and Nakagawa's voices are too similar. If it weren't for Maizuru using "boku", you wouldn't be able to tell them apart. It's a tough story to adapt to audio, and they pulled it off nicely.
